Недорогой корпоративный чат-сервер с API

В моем проекте мы оцениваем сервер Atlassian HipChat , но это очень дорого, если вы пройдете 10 пользователей . Мне нужна альтернатива, которая соответствует как можно большему количеству следующих критериев:

  • Развернуть на нашем собственном сервере (иначе мы бы использовали Slack)
  • На базе Windows (хотя бесплатный/дешевый Linux может быть вариантом по сравнению с дорогой Windows).
  • У него есть API , поэтому можно использовать ChatBot (например, Hubot ) .
  • Это с открытым исходным кодом / бесплатно или не очень дорого.
Сырая идея (не уверен, что это будет соответствовать вашим потребностям): Зарегистрируйте IRC-канал (например, на Freenode) и используйте, например, SupyBot или любого другого бота, совместимого с IRC?
Может быть... но одно требование состоит в том, что он должен размещаться внутри (иначе я бы использовал Slack)
Хорошо, так что все будет в порядке, если есть IRC-сервер, который вы можете разместить самостоятельно (на всякий случай, если кто-то его придумает), верно?
Вы должны иметь возможность разместить свой собственный irc-сервер, если хотите.

Ответы (1)

Может быть, вы ищете Mattermost . Вы можете скачать его и установить на свой сервер, например, через Docker для Windows . У него есть API , и вы можете использовать скомпилированные версии под лицензией MIT.

Вы также можете посмотреть на 4 альтернативы Slack с открытым исходным кодом для командного чата .

Mattermost предназначен для Linux, но может быть хорошей альтернативой. Спасибо